In this episode, we look at Falcon Gold Crop (FG.V), a Canadian mineral exploration company engaging in the acquisition and exploration of mineral properties in the Americas. They’re currently worth $11 million, have 9 active projects in total, and currently trade at roughly 10 cents per share (at the time of this video). We break down what this could all mean to us.
